The Triplets
The Triplets are a playful development from a past design of a single jug. I wanted to explore the form further and this little set were created. They have the same main form but each has their own individual character, dictated by their spouts. They have form and fuction, the quality of the pour was very important to me so each spout underwent thorough testing and tweaking to ensure it was just right.
From cream, to water for your favourite whiskey, to oils for your salads, these little pouring vessels are endlessly useful and here to be enjoyed. Can be gold plated inside; if this is something you would like, please get in touch.
I am interested in the relationship my pieces have with each other, how they are rigid yet have a sense of association when placed in their groupings, connecting with their counterparts. The pieces have a matt finish to the exterior which looks warm and inviting to handle, allowing the viewer to physically interact with each piece as it is important to me that my pieces are as good to use as they are to hold, and to look at. A contrasting polished rim gives the form a confident line.
Made from a good thickness of silver they are a satisfying weight. These can be gold plated to give the interior a warm golden glow.
Sterling Silver. Hallmarked by London Assay Office. Approx 6cm tall.
